Pricing
Coûts des Installation et construction de piscine à Hamilton
Typical rates: $80-$150/hour (specialist crew)
| Service | Coût estimé (CAD) |
|---|---|
| Vinyl liner inground pool (14x28) | $50,000-$80,000 |
| Fiberglass inground pool (14x28) | $60,000-$100,000 |
| Concrete/gunite inground pool (custom) | $80,000-$150,000+ |
| Above-ground pool installation (24ft round) | $5,000-$12,000 |
| Pool fencing (to code, per linear ft) | $30-$80 |
| Pool deck (concrete or paver) | $8,000-$25,000 |
| Pool heater installation | $3,000-$7,000 |
| Salt water system conversion | $2,500-$5,000 |
Ce qui affecte les prix: Pool type (vinyl liner is most affordable, concrete/gunite is most expensive), pool size and shape (custom shapes cost more), excavation conditions (rock, high water table, or limited access add $5,000-$15,000), decking and coping materials, equipment (pump, filter, heater, salt system), required fencing to meet municipal pool enclosure bylaws, permit fees ($500-$2,000), landscaping restoration, and electrical hookup (must be done by a licensed electrician). GTA prices are 15-20% higher than smaller Ontario markets.

Licences en Ontario
Pool installation in Ontario is regulated through municipal building permits and the Ontario Building Code. A building permit is required for pool enclosure (fencing) in most municipalities, and many require permits for the pool itself if it holds more than 600mm (24 inches) of water. Electrical work for pool equipment must be performed by an ESA-licensed electrician, and gas heater installation requires a TSSA gas technician certificate. Pool contractors are not required to hold a specific provincial licence, but reputable builders carry liability insurance and are often members of the Pool and Hot Tub Council of Canada. A property survey conducted within one year is typically required for the permit application.
Organisme de réglementation: Municipal building departments (permits and pool enclosure bylaws); ESA for electrical; TSSA for gas heater work
Timing
Quand embaucher un Installation et construction de piscine
À quoi s'attendre
The builder will do a site assessment, review your property survey, and present design options within your budget. After permit approval, work begins with excavation, followed by pool shell installation or forming, plumbing, electrical rough-in, decking, and equipment installation. A final inspection by the municipality is required for the pool enclosure. The builder should commission the equipment and provide a detailed handover on pool operation and maintenance.
Above-ground pool: 1-3 days. Vinyl liner inground pool: 4-8 weeks. Fiberglass inground pool: 3-6 weeks. Concrete/gunite inground pool: 8-16 weeks. Permit approval adds 2-6 weeks before construction begins. Most pools are completed within a single season.
Comment se préparer
Obtain a current property survey (required for permits). Check your municipal zoning bylaws for setback requirements and lot coverage limits. Call Ontario One Call (1-800-400-2255) to locate underground utilities. Confirm your homeowner's insurance will cover the pool. Budget for ongoing annual maintenance costs ($1,500-$3,000/year) in addition to the installation cost.
Hiring guide
Guide d'embauche
Questions à poser
- 1 Do you carry liability insurance, and what is your coverage limit?
- 2 Will you handle all permits, inspections, and the required property survey?
- 3 What equipment brands do you install, and what warranties do they carry?
- 4 What is included in the contract, and what are potential extras (fencing, landscaping restoration, electrical)?
- 5 Can I visit a pool you recently completed and speak with the homeowner?
Signaux d'alerte à surveiller
-
No written contract detailing pool specifications, equipment, timeline, and total installed cost
-
Cannot provide proof of liability insurance (minimum $2M recommended for pool construction)
-
Skips the permit process or tells you permits are unnecessary
-
No references from completed pool builds in your area
-
Quotes dramatically below market rates - pool construction has real minimum costs for materials and labour
Haute saison
Pool builders book up quickly in spring for summer completion. Many reputable builders are fully committed by March for the current season. Construction runs from April through October, weather permitting.
Meilleur moment pour réserver
Fall and winter (October-February) for design consultations and contract signing, with construction scheduled for early spring. This gives you the best chance of swimming by July. Some builders offer off-season discounts of 5-10% for contracts signed before March.
